About the role

  • Support three lawyers with their administrative needs
  • Manage calendars and schedule appointments using Outlook and various planning tools
  • Oversee and update electronic and physical task management systems
  • Complete monthly reconciliations of expenses for assigned lawyers
  • Provide support for litigation and regulatory matters
  • Organize and manage complex electronic and paper filing systems
  • Draft, edit, format, and organize various materials for electronic or print use
  • Arrange meetings and manage documents and logistical support
  • Manage client documentation, pleadings, corporate records, briefs, and reports
  • Support reviewing and organizing documentary evidence for complex cases
  • Schedule court appointments and coordinate with court offices
  • Interpret court rules for multiple jurisdictions
  • File and coordinate service of court documents
  • Handle necessary document scanning and photocopying
  • Schedule and coordinate frequent travel arrangements
  • Reception duties including welcoming guests and answering phones
  • Daily management of the physical office
  • Perform additional administrative tasks as needed to support the team.

Requirements

  • Bilingual (English/French), both spoken and written
  • Graduate of an accredited Legal or Administrative Assistant program or equivalent experience
  • 4+ years of experience as a Legal Assistant or in a similar role, or equivalent experience
  • Strong organizational and prioritization skills, with the ability to work independently
  • Excellent technical skills and meticulous attention to detail
  • Strong teamwork and interpersonal skills
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ications
  • Knowledge of legal software such as iManage and Cosmolex
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ment, adapt to shifting priorities, and meet tight deadlines
  • Self-motivated, proactive, and able to complete tasks with minimal supervision
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to work effectively under pressure.
